site stats

How hashmap is implemented in java

WebThe HashMap class of the Java collections framework provides the functionality of the hash table data structure. It stores elements in key/value pairs. Here, keys are unique identifiers used to associate each value on a map. The HashMap class implements the Map interface. Java HashMap Implementation Create a HashMap Web18 aug. 2024 · Java For Each Hashmap - It stores elements in key/value pairs. Map interface didn’t extend a collection interface and hence it will not have its own iterator. The foreach method performs the action specified by lambda expression for each entry of the hashmap. Let us move forward and discuss all possible ways to iterate

Java: Java 8 : how to extract a HashMap from a ArrayList of HashMap …

WebThe default implementation of hashCode() in Object Class returns distinct integers for different objects. The hash code is depend up on the two parameters (1) Object type WebPlease consume this content on nados.pepcoding.com for a richer experience. It is necessary to solve the questions while watching videos, nados.pepcoding.com... otis clark https://iihomeinspections.com

How HashSet works in Java [Explained with Example] Java67

Web16 dec. 2014 · 1. HashMap.get () operation with proper hashCode () logic 2. HashMap.get () operation with broken (hashCode is same for all Keys) hashCode () logic 3. HashMap.put () operation with proper hashCode () logic 4. HashMap.put () operation with broken (hashCode is same for all Keys) hashCode () logic WebHashMap works on the principle of hashing data structure or technique that uses an object’s hashcode to place that object inside the map. Hashing involves Bucket, Hash function (hashCode () method), and Hash value. It provides the best time complexity of O (1) for insertion and retrieval of objects. Web14 apr. 2024 · Step4: Insert the element into the hashmap along with it’s updated frequency in step 2. Step5: Insert the element into the hashmap with its frequency as 1. Step6: If … rockport ma community house

Array : Is HashMap internally implemented in Java using

Category:Working of HashMap in Java How HashMap works

Tags:How hashmap is implemented in java

How hashmap is implemented in java

Java并发编程:HashMap与ConcurrentHashMap的线程安全性 - 简书

Web20 feb.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Web2 dec. 2015 · In hashMap, bucket uses simple linkedlist to store objects. 2. HashMap implementation inside Java. In HashMap, get(Object key) calls hashCode() on the key …

How hashmap is implemented in java

Did you know?

Web11 apr. 2024 · In Java, both HashSet and HashMap are data structures that use hashing to store and retrieve elements quickly. While both of these collections use a hash table to store their elements, there are ... Web5 sep. 2024 · 3. Implement your HashMap 3.1 Map Interface. The top interface of HashMap is Map, which means we need our own interface if we want to implement our own map. The map interface of our HashMap is defined as MyMap and it should have these three functions: put(K k,V v) get(K k) size() and an internal interface. Entry It should …

WebHashMap contains an array of the nodes, and the node is represented as a class. It uses an array and LinkedList data structure internally for storing Key and Value. There are four fields in HashMap. Before … Web#smartprogramming #deepakpanwar #javaprogramming #java #javacollections This tutorial includes HashMap constructors and methods, and its practical example. M...

Web17 jun. 2024 · Java HashMap internal Implementation. HashMap is the data structure used in Java to store key-value pairs, where the average retrieval time for get () and put … Web3 jan. 2015 · This HashMap object is used to store the elements you enter in the HashSet. The elements you add into HashSet are stored as keys of this HashMap object. The value associated with those keys will be a constant. In this post, we will see how HashSet works internally in Java with an example.

WebI'm practicing handwriting my own simpler version of a Java HashMap. I don't have much experience with generics in Java. public your HashMap { private class Entry {

Web18 aug. 2024 · HashMap Implementation for Java HashMap is a dictionary data structure provided by java. It’s a Map-based collection class that is used to store data in Key & … rockport ma hiking trailsWeb17 aug. 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. rockport ma day tripWebThe implementation of HashMap went from 1k lines of code in java 7 to 2k lines of code in java 8. In java 8, Node class contains the exact same information as the Entry class i.e Node class contains ( hash , key, value, bucketindex). Here is the implementation of the Node class in java 8. rockport ma hotels on beachrockport maine boat clubWebJava HashMap class implements the Map interface which allows us to store key and value pair, where keys should be unique. If you try to insert the duplicate key, it will replace the … rockport maine current weatherWeb23 aug. 2024 · How HashMap Works in Java Internal Implementation of HashMap Byte Programming 10.7K subscribers Subscribe Like Share 20K views 2 years ago Java This video talks about How HashMap works... otis clark interviewWeb13 feb. 2024 · HashMap has an array of HashMap.Entry objects : /** * The table, resized as necessary. Length MUST Always be a power of two. */ transient Entry[] table; We … otis clarke usc